Silicone edge banding stands apart from traditional PVC or ABS bands. Its unique properties – supreme flexibility, excellent water resistance, and high-temperature tolerance – make it ideal for applications in moisture-prone areas like kitchens and bathrooms, or on surfaces requiring a soft, resilient edge. However, these very qualities, particularly its strong, flexible adhesion, can make removal a distinct challenge compared to more rigid materials. The goal is not just to pull the strip off, but to do so without damaging the underlying substrate and to meticulously clean away all adhesive remnants, which can be surprisingly tenacious.

I. Understanding the Challenge: Why Silicone is Different


Unlike hot-melt adhesives used with PVC or ABS, silicone sealants and adhesives create a remarkably strong, often semi-permanent bond that is resistant to many common solvents. When it cures, silicone forms a rubber-like, elastic material that can stretch rather than break, making it difficult to simply "peel" away. Furthermore, its residue, if not properly handled, can be a magnet for dust and dirt, leading to unsightly marks and an uneven surface that will hinder the application of any new finish or edge banding. II. Essential Tools and Safety Precautions: Preparation is Key


Before embarking on any removal project, meticulous preparation is not just recommended – it's paramount for safety and success. Gathering the right tools beforehand will save you time and frustration.

Safety First:



Gloves: Wear robust work gloves to protect your hands from cuts, scrapes, and chemical exposure.
Eye Protection: Safety glasses are crucial to shield your eyes from flying debris or chemical splashes.
Ventilation: When using chemical solvents, ensure the work area is well-ventilated. Open windows and doors, or use fans, to disperse fumes.
Mask: For prolonged exposure to solvent fumes, a respirator mask designed for organic vapors is advisable.

Essential Tools You'll Need:



Utility Knife or Razor Blade: A sharp, retractable utility knife with fresh blades is indispensable for scoring and precise cutting. Single-edged razor blades can also be highly effective for delicate work.
Plastic Scraper or Putty Knife: Avoid metal scrapers initially, as they can easily scratch or gouge the underlying furniture surface. Start with plastic scrapers (old credit cards, plastic spatulas work too) for prying and scraping. A thin, flexible metal putty knife can be used cautiously for tougher spots.
Specialized Silicone Removal Tool: Some hardware stores offer tools specifically designed for silicone removal, often with different angled ends for cutting and scraping.
Heat Gun or Hairdryer (Optional, Use with Extreme Caution): Gentle heat can sometimes soften silicone, making it easier to remove. However, excessive heat can damage furniture finishes, warp wood, or melt laminates. Use sparingly and carefully.
Pliers or Tweezers: For gripping and pulling small pieces of silicone.
Clean Rags or Microfiber Cloths: For applying solvents and wiping away residue.
Isopropyl Alcohol (Rubbing Alcohol): Excellent for cleaning fresh silicone residue and as a general degreaser.
Mineral Spirits (White Spirit) or Paint Thinner: More effective on cured silicone residue, but always test on an inconspicuous area first, as it can affect some finishes.
Specialized Silicone Removers: Products specifically formulated to break down cured silicone (e.g., silicone caulk removers). These are often the most effective but also require careful handling and testing.
Acetone (Nail Polish Remover - Test First!): Can be very effective on silicone but is extremely aggressive and will damage most finishes, plastics, and laminates. Use ONLY as a last resort and with extreme caution, testing first.
Vacuum Cleaner: To clean up any dust or debris after removal.

III. Step-by-Step Removal Process: Precision and Patience


Follow these steps carefully to ensure a clean and damage-free removal.

Step 1: Area Assessment and Preparation



Begin by clearing the work area around the furniture or cabinet. Remove any drawers, doors, or items that might obstruct access or be damaged during the process. Lay down drop cloths or old towels to protect flooring and adjacent surfaces from tools or chemical drips. Visually inspect the silicone edge banding to understand its adhesion points and thickness.

Step 2: Initial Scoring for Clean Separation



This is perhaps the most critical step to prevent damage to the furniture surface. Using a sharp utility knife or razor blade, carefully score a line precisely where the silicone edge banding meets the furniture surface. The goal is to cut through the silicone's top layer of adhesion without cutting into the furniture itself. For thicker banding, you might need to score along both the top and bottom edges. Be steady and apply consistent, moderate pressure. Do not try to cut deep on the first pass; multiple light passes are safer and more effective. This scoring helps to break the bond and prevents the silicone from tearing off chips of the underlying finish when pulled.

Step 3: The Gentle Peel – Starting the Removal



Once scored, try to find a starting point, ideally a corner or an end, where the silicone might be slightly looser. Gently attempt to lift an edge using your fingernail, a plastic scraper, or the tip of a utility knife (very carefully, tip-up, to avoid scratching). Once you have a small section lifted, try to pull the silicone strip away slowly and steadily. Pull it back towards itself at a shallow angle, rather than straight up. This technique helps the silicone peel away from the surface rather than break into small pieces. Patience is paramount here; rushing will likely result in tearing the silicone and leaving more residue.

Step 4: Tackling Stubborn Sections – Patience is Key



As you pull, you will inevitably encounter sections where the silicone is more firmly adhered.

Prying: Use your plastic scraper or a thin putty knife to gently pry and separate the silicone from the surface. Slide the scraper underneath the lifted portion and carefully work it along the adhesive line.
Gentle Heat (Use with Extreme Caution): For particularly stubborn spots, a hairdryer on a low-to-medium setting or a heat gun on its lowest setting can be used. Hold the heat source several inches away from the silicone and move it constantly to prevent scorching. Apply heat for only 10-15 seconds at a time. The aim is to slightly soften the silicone and its adhesive properties, not to melt or damage the furniture. Test a small, hidden area first if unsure about your furniture's heat tolerance.
Re-scoring: If the silicone is breaking into small pieces, it often indicates the initial score wasn't deep enough, or the adhesion is too strong. Re-score the problematic section carefully and try peeling again.

Step 5: The Residue Removal Challenge



Once the bulk of the silicone strip is removed, you will almost certainly be left with a sticky, tacky residue. This is often the most time-consuming part of the process and requires different techniques.

Mechanical Removal:



Scraping: Use your plastic scraper or a dedicated silicone removal tool to gently scrape away as much of the thick residue as possible. Hold the scraper at a low angle to avoid scratching.
Rubbing: For thin films of residue, sometimes simply rubbing it with your finger or a clean cloth can cause it to "ball up" and peel off. This works best on very fresh or thin layers.

Chemical Removal (Always Test First!):



Chemical removers are essential for tackling the remaining tenacious residue. Always test any solvent on an inconspicuous area of your furniture (e.g., inside a cabinet door, under an overhang) to ensure it doesn't damage the finish, discolor the material, or cause swelling.

Isopropyl Alcohol: Dip a clean rag or cotton ball in isopropyl alcohol and gently rub the residue. It's effective on lighter, fresher silicone and acts as a good degreaser. Allow it to sit for a minute or two to loosen the bond, then wipe or gently scrape.
Mineral Spirits (White Spirit): For tougher, cured silicone residue, mineral spirits can be very effective. Apply it to a rag, press it onto the residue for a few minutes (without letting it pool), and then rub vigorously. It helps break down the silicone polymers.
Specialized Silicone Removers: These products are specifically engineered to dissolve cured silicone. Follow the manufacturer's instructions carefully. They often require a dwell time (e.g., 30 minutes to an hour) to work their magic. After the recommended time, the residue should be much easier to scrape or wipe away.
Acetone (Extreme Caution): As mentioned, acetone is a powerful solvent. While it can dissolve silicone, it will also likely dissolve or damage many types of paint, varnish, plastic, and laminate. Only consider it if other methods fail, for very resistant residue on highly durable, solvent-resistant surfaces (e.g., some metals or unfinished wood), and always with a tiny test patch first.

Step 6: Final Cleaning and Surface Preparation



Once all the silicone and its residue are removed, wipe the entire surface down with a clean rag dampened with a mild cleaner (e.g., diluted dish soap, glass cleaner) to remove any remaining solvent film or dirt. Finish by wiping with a clean, dry cloth. The surface should feel completely smooth, non-tacky, and clean. This is crucial for any subsequent application, whether it's new edge banding, paint, or varnish. Any lingering residue will compromise the adhesion of new materials.

IV. Advanced Tips & Troubleshooting
Working on Different Substrates:

Laminate Surfaces: These are particularly vulnerable to scratching and solvent damage. Use plastic scrapers exclusively and test solvents very carefully. Avoid excessive moisture or heat, which can delaminate the surface.
Solid Wood: Solid wood can tolerate slightly more aggressive scraping, but still proceed with caution to avoid gouging. If you scratch the wood, light sanding might be an option if you plan to refinish.
Painted or Varnished Surfaces: These are very sensitive to strong solvents. Stick to isopropyl alcohol or specialized silicone removers specifically labeled as "safe for painted surfaces," and always test first.
Metal Surfaces: Generally more robust, metal can withstand stronger solvents like mineral spirits or even acetone (if no painted finish is present). Metal scrapers can be used but still risk scratching, so proceed with care.


Preventing Surface Damage: The golden rule is always to start with the least invasive method and gradually increase intensity. Use sharp blades to minimize pressure. Use the right tool for the job – a plastic scraper for a delicate surface, for instance.
Stubborn Residue – When All Else Fails: If you're faced with incredibly persistent residue, re-apply a specialized silicone remover, cover it with plastic wrap (to prevent evaporation), and let it sit for a longer period (e.g., several hours or overnight, as per product instructions). This allows the chemicals more time to penetrate and break down the silicone.
When to Call a Professional: If you're dealing with a highly valuable piece of furniture, an intricate design, or if you're uncomfortable using strong chemicals, it's always wise to consult a professional furniture restorer or cleaner.
Disposal: Dispose of silicone waste and solvent-soaked rags according to local regulations. Silicone is generally inert, but chemicals need careful handling.
